BUSINESS NEWS
- ➤ Local officials and business partners introduced the Memorial Gift Card Program to help shops along the Memorial Highway during ongoing reconstruction by offering a 25% bonus on gift card purchases of $40 to $500. The program, which includes 11 businesses and will have bonus cards that expire Dec. 31, is designed to boost patronage + attract new visitors. KFYR-TV
CRIME NEWS
- ➤ NDDSVC served over 7,600 victims of domestic violence and sexual assault in 2024—record numbers with 6,334 domestic violence cases and 1,363 sexual assault cases that rose 3.3% and 5.8% from 2023. The report also found that most domestic violence victims were women and many had disabilities while more than 4,700 children were affected. KX News
- ➤ A Mandan woman who crashed her vehicle into a bridge support on Interstate 94 while fleeing police in January was sentenced to three years in prison on Thursday. Bismarck Tribune
EDUCATION NEWS
- ➤ Educators from across North Dakota gathered in Bismarck at IgniteND to learn how to bring computer science, artificial intelligence and other tech tools into classrooms — the event took place at the new Advanced Technology Center and organizers are already planning next year's conference. KX News
